Output 1651320aa92249e62a9b9a76f25e54b9c3f94990d74849e18cfff581ac1a3be2:156

value
5314751555
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20070996d0bbf6a3cc3387491fe76398f1603849 OP_EQUALVERIFY OP_CHECKSIG
address
D84SbNJeoxVwmg16yppRda4QaSckdsys6y
transaction
1651320aa92249e62a9b9a76f25e54b9c3f94990d74849e18cfff581ac1a3be2